GATE XL cutoff 2026 - IIT Guwahati has released the GATE 2026 XL cutoff on March 28, 2026. According to the notification, the GATE XL 2026 cutoff is 36.3 for the general category, 32.6 for OBC-NCL candidates, and 24.1 for SC/ST candidates. Students can check the GATE XL 2026 cutoffs from the official website, gate2026.iitg.ac.in. The GATE cutoff 2026 indicates the minimum scores that candidates need to obtain to qualify for the exam. Only those candidates who clear the cutoff can participate in the GATE 2026 counselling. The XL cutoff for the GATE 2026 exam will differ every year based on the difficulty level of the exam, the number of students who attempted the exam and the number of seats available. To have a better understanding of the upcoming GATE XL cutoff, candidates can check out the previous year’s cutoff trends. The GATE cutoff percentiles from 2022 to 2025 have been mentioned in the table below. Knowing this will help candidates know how much they have to aim for in the GATE exam to clear the cutoff.
GATE Exam Year | Qualifying Marks for GATE Life Sciences (XL paper) | ||
Cut-off (GEN) | Cut-off (OBC-NCL/EWS) | Cut-off (SC/ST/PwD) | |
2025 | 31.3 | 28.1 | 20.8 |
2024 | 29.3 | 26.3 | 19.5 |
2023 | 32.9 | 29.6 | 21.9 3 |
2022 | 33.9 | 30.5 | 22.5 |
To calculate their GATE cutoff, candidates must have an overall idea of the GATE marking scheme. Check the table for the marking scheme process.
Question Type | Marks | Negative Marking |
Multiple Choice Question (MCQ) | 1 marks | For a 1-mark MCQ, 1/3 mark will be deducted for a wrong answer. |
Multiple Choice Question (MCQ) | 2 marks | For a 2-mark MCQ, 2/3 marks will be deducted for a wrong answer. |
Multiple Select Question (MSQ) | 1 or 2 marks | There is no negative marking for wrong answer(s) to MSQ or NAT questions. |
Number Answer Type (NAT) |
The GATE cutoff is of 2 types. The difference between the two is mentioned below.
Qualifying Cutoff - This is the minimum mark required to qualify for the GATE exam. Candidates who clear the qualifying cutoff will be eligible to participate in the COAP 2026 counselling. The GATE qualifying cutoff will be determined by the exam conducting authority.
Admission Cutoff - This is the minimum score required for admission to the participating institutions. This will be determined by the respective institute. The admission cutoff is usually higher than the qualifying cutoff.
